Dentists SEO Pricing Breakdown
Not all SEO services are created equal, and the cheapest option rarely delivers the best value. Here's what each tier looks like for a dental practice in Canberra:
| Package | Monthly Cost | What's Included |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Starter | $500 | Google Business Profile optimisation, 20 citations/month, weekly GBP posts, basic on-page SEO | Practices testing SEO or maintaining existing rankings |
| Growth | $1,000 | Everything in Starter + 40 citations/month, 15 quality backlinks, 10 location/service pages, monthly reporting | Most Canberra dentists wanting steady growth |
| Domination | $2,000 | Everything in Growth + 80 citations/month, 30 backlinks, 30+ optimised pages, full website build/overhaul, review management | Multi-location practices or those in competitive suburbs |
The Starter package works if you already rank on page one for a few terms and need someone to keep the engine running. It covers the fundamentals—making sure your Google Business Profile is fully optimised, your NAP (name, address, phone) data is consistent across directories, and you're posting regularly enough that Google sees your profile as active.
The Growth package is where real momentum happens. At this tier, you're building dedicated pages for every service you offer—teeth whitening, dental implants, emergency dentistry, Invisalign—and every suburb you want to attract patients from. Fifteen quality backlinks per month from relevant Australian websites signals to Google that your practice is authoritative and trustworthy. For most single-location dental practices in Canberra, this is the sweet spot.
The Domination package is built for practices ready to own their market. If you operate across Belconnen, Woden, Tuggeranong, and the CBD, or if you're competing against well-established practices with years of SEO behind them, this level of investment gives you the firepower to close the gap fast. It includes a full website build or overhaul, ensuring your site loads fast, converts visitors into bookings, and meets Google's Core Web Vitals benchmarks.

What Affects SEO Pricing for Dentists
Four factors determine whether you'll land at the lower or upper end of the pricing spectrum.
Competition level. Canberra's dental market isn't as saturated as Sydney or Melbourne, but certain suburbs are fiercely competitive. If three established practices in Braddon are already investing in SEO, unseating them takes more content, more backlinks, and more time than ranking in a less contested area like Gungahlin or Weston Creek.
Number of service areas. A single-location practice targeting patients within a 10-kilometre radius needs fewer location pages than a multi-location group trying to dominate the entire ACT. Every additional suburb you want to rank in requires dedicated content, local citations, and geo-targeted backlinks.
Current rankings and domain authority. If your website has been live for five years with decent content and a handful of backlinks, you have a head start. If you're launching a brand-new site on a fresh domain, expect to invest more upfront to build authority from scratch.
Website quality. A slow, outdated website with no mobile optimisation is an anchor on your SEO campaign. If your site takes more than three seconds to load, Google penalises you in rankings. Some agencies quote low monthly fees but neglect to mention the $3,000–$8,000 website rebuild you'll need before SEO can actually work. DIY vs Agency SEO for Dentists
You can absolutely do SEO yourself. The question is whether you should.
DIY SEO requires 10–15 hours per month of focused work: updating your Google Business Profile, writing blog posts, building citations manually, researching keywords, monitoring rankings, fixing technical issues, and chasing backlinks. That's before you factor in the learning curve. SEO best practices shift constantly, and what worked in 2024 can actively hurt you in 2026.
The tool costs alone add up. A proper SEO stack—Ahrefs or SEMrush for keyword research, Surfer for content optimisation, BrightLocal for citation management—runs $200–$500 per month. So "free" DIY SEO actually costs $200+ in tools plus the opportunity cost of your time.
If your hourly rate as a dentist is $300 (a conservative estimate), spending 12 hours on SEO instead of treating patients costs you $3,600 per month in lost production. That's more than three times the cost of hiring a professional agency to handle everything for you.
DIY makes sense if you're genuinely passionate about digital marketing and have spare capacity. For everyone else, partnering with a specialist dental SEO agency is the more profitable path.
ROI Calculator for Dentists SEO
Let's run the numbers with conservative assumptions.
A typical dental practice in Canberra charges $200 for a check-up and clean, $500 for a crown, and $3,000–$5,000 for implant work. The average new patient is worth roughly $800 in their first year and $2,500+ over their lifetime.
Assume a Growth SEO campaign at $1,000/month generates 20 additional website visitors per month who call or book online. At a 25% conversion rate (realistic for a well-optimised website), that's 5 new patients per month.
Monthly new patient revenue: 5 patients × $800 average first-year value = $4,000 Monthly SEO investment: $1,000 Monthly ROI: 300%
Over 12 months, that's $48,000 in new patient revenue from a $12,000 investment—a 4x return. Factor in lifetime patient value and referrals, and the true ROI climbs to 8–10x.
The compounding effect matters too. Unlike paid ads that stop generating leads the moment you pause spend, SEO builds equity. The pages you rank today continue attracting patients for years with minimal ongoing investment.
Red Flags: SEO Agencies to Avoid
The dental SEO space attracts its share of cowboys. Watch for these warning signs before signing anything.
Lock-in contracts. If an agency requires a 12-month commitment with hefty exit fees, ask yourself why they need a contract to keep you. Good results keep clients. Handcuffs don't.
Guaranteed #1 rankings. No one can guarantee the top spot on Google. Anyone who promises this is either lying or planning to use black-hat tactics that will get your site penalised. Google's algorithm weighs hundreds of factors—no agency controls them all.
No transparent reporting. If you can't see exactly what work was done each month, what rankings moved, and how many leads came through, you're flying blind. Demand monthly reports with clear metrics.
Offshore link building on the cheap. Bulk links from irrelevant overseas directories or spammy blog networks do more harm than good. Google's spam detection in 2026 is sophisticated enough to identify and penalise these patterns within weeks.
Vague deliverables. "We'll optimise your website" means nothing without specifics. How many pages? Which keywords? How many backlinks, and from what sources? Pin down the scope before you pay.
